In this spine-chilling episode of our Tales of Horror, we explore the haunting world of “The Prowler”, a 1981 slasher film that has earned its place as a cult classic in the horror genre. Join us as we dissect the creative minds behind the film, including director Joseph Zito and screenwriters Neal Barbera and Glenn Leopold. We'll delve into the performances of Vicky Dawson, Christopher Goutman, and Lawrence Tierney, while also paying homage to the legendary special effects by Tom Savini that brought the film's terrifying imagery to life. Tune in as we uncover the film's chilling narrative, its impact on the slasher movement, and why it continues to captivate horror fans decades after its release. Picking this film for this discussion is Roger Conners, otherwise known as “The Scream Queer” on Instagram and part of the Dark Night of the Podcast! His energy and knowledge was perfect for us to dive into this film, which is far much more than some of its slasher movie counterparts. Recognized as one of Cleveland Ohio's premier independent film actors, Roger Conners has become a well-known name within the cult-horror scene after appearing in a wide array of widely publicized b-horror classics. Born in Westlake, Ohio, an upper-class suburb located less than twenty minutes outside of Cleveland, he grew up with an intense passion for acting and the arts. After expressing interest in working on camera, he was quickly cast in a leading role in 529 Films "Hellementary: An Education in Death". Earning significant attention both within Cleveland and beyond, the film went on to have its national television premiere in 2010. Upon the films success, Roger decided to focus mainly on acting within the horror genre. After appearing in an array of independent horror films he was dubbed as being horrors first "Scream Queer", a spin on the classic term "Scream Queen". The first film this week is THE CURSE OF LILITH RATCHET from director Eddie Lengyel where a radio host mistakenly conjures the vengeance ghost of an angry witch. The second film is THE HOUSE from director Reinert Kiil follows a pair of Nazi soldiers and their Norwegian captive to an isolated haunted house deep in the snowy mountains.
